Unhealthy Leaves and Bark

Unhealthy leaves and bark signal potential problems that may jeopardize a tree's health. Discoloration, such as yellowing or browning leaves, often indicates nutrient deficiencies or disease. Furthermore, wilting or early leaf drop may indicate stress or pest infestations. Bark issues, including cracks, peeling, or discoloration, may reveal underlying diseases or pest damage. Fungal growth on the bark can further signify decay, compromising the tree's structural integrity. Observing these symptoms early is essential, as they often escalate without intervention. Qualified tree service professionals are able to accurately assess the issues, delivering proper treatments or suggesting removal if required. Taking swift action to address unhealthy leaves and bark helps maintain the tree's well-being and has a positive impact on the surrounding environment.

Structural Weakness or Leaning

When trees display structural instability or lean noticeably, it commonly points to underlying concerns that demand expert assessment. Trees that lean may be attributed to numerous factors, including root damage, soil erosion, or inadequate anchorage. This instability presents dangers not only to the tree's wellbeing but also to surrounding structures and people. A tree with excessive lean may become more prone to falling during severe more information storms or powerful winds, posing significant hazards. Moreover, evidence of uneven growth or lopsided canopies may signal that a tree is finding it challenging to preserve its balance. Professionals equipped with the right tools and expertise can evaluate the situation, determine the cause, and recommend appropriate interventions, ensuring both the tree's safety and the surrounding environment.

Dead or Failing Branches

Observing dead or dying limbs is a clear indicator that a tree may require professional attention. These limbs can negatively affect the overall health of the tree, making it prone to pests and diseases. In addition, they present a safety hazard, as they can drop without warning, potentially causing personal injury or structural damage. A tree showing signs of dead or dying branches may also point to underlying issues such as nutrient deficiencies, root damage, or disease. Routine evaluation by a certified arborist can aid in evaluating the tree's condition and identify the best course of action. Prompt action not only strengthens the tree's vitality but also guarantees a safer environment for nearby structures and individuals. Addressing these issues promptly can reduce the likelihood of greater complications later on.

What Are the Typical Costs Associated with Professional Tree Removal?

Professional tree removal generally ranges between $200 and $2,000, depending on factors such as tree size, location, and difficulty of removal. Further charges may stem from permits or specialized equipment needed for the job.

What Time of Year Is Best for Tree Trimming?

The optimal time for tree trimming generally falls in the late winter or early spring months before fresh growth starts to develop. This approach supports vigorous regrowth and reduces stress on the tree, guaranteeing optimal health and appearance.
